FREDERIKSTED — A St. Croix man was arrested on domestic violence charges after he allegedly assaulted his pregnant girlfriend, authorities said.

Rhasanie Hendrickson, 18, of Mount Pleasant West, was arrested at 11:32 a.m. Friday and charged with aggravated assault & battery-domestic violence, the Virgin Islands Police Department said.

“Hendrickson allegedly assaulted his pregnant significant other, causing visible injuries,” VIPD spokesman Toby Derima said.

The unnamed victim was transported by police to the Juan F. Luis Hospital and Medical Center for treatment, Derima said.

Hendrickson was not offered bail, pursuant to the territory’s domestic violence statutes.

He was remanded to the custody of the Bureau of Corrections pending an advice-of-rights hearing.

St. Croix District Chief of Police Sidney Elskoe reminds the community that there is no excuse for domestic violence.

“During disagreements, tempers may flare. However, resorting to violence against your significant other will get you arrested,” Chief Elskoe said, adding that he suggests taking a “time out” from the situation, allowing tempers to cool.
